Trailer Wiring Diagram For 4 Way, 5 Way, 6 Way and 7 Way circuits
6 Way System, Rectangle Plug. 3/4 inch by 1 inch 6 way rectangle connectors right turn signal (green), left turn signal (yellow), taillight (brown), ground (white). The red and blue wire can be used for brake control or auxiliary. Use on a small motorcycle trailer, snowmobile trailer or

The black battery wire should be same size as the white ground wire - 10 gauge in chart - faq311-7-way-trailer-diagram-rv_2_800 The picture below this chart shows correct wiring for RV plugs. As a professional RV transporter I have seen to many trucks wired with those 2 wires to small and cause a fire from overheating.

Trailer electrical connectors come in a variety of shapes and sizes. The basic purpose remains the same whether your truck and trailer is using a 4-way, 5-way, 6-way or 7-way connector. By law, trailer lighting must be connected into the tow vehicle's wiring system to provide trailer running lights, turn signals and brake lights.

CaravansPlus: How To Identify & Check Axle Bearings
A bearing comprises of two parts; the cup which is pressed into the hub and also the cone that contains the rollers. The smaller cup & cone are called the outer bearings, because they fit the outside face of the wheel with the grease cap. The grease seal and inner bearings go on the inside toward the centre of the trailer or caravan.
